Mr. Alvarez has a notecard that measures 6/100 by 11 /100 meters the whole note card is coverd with square stickers the side of

each sticker measures 1/100 meters none of the stickers over lap what are the number of stickers needed to cover the notecard

Answer:

  66

Step-by-step explanation:

The card is covered with (6/100)/(1/100) = 6 stickers along the short dimension, and (11/100)/(1/100) = 11 stickers along the long dimension.

The number of stickers on the card is 6×11 = 66.
